Sequoia closes $200m seed fund, boosts Israeli focus
Sequoia Capital has closed a US$200 million seed fund, with a significant portion directed to Israeli startups, according to partner Shaun Maguire.
The firm also announced a US$750 million fund for series A investments.
Despite the ongoing conflict in Gaza, Sequoia’s investment strategy in Israel remains unchanged, with around 20% of recent seed fund capital going to Israeli companies or those with strong Israeli ties.
Recent investments include Decart, an AI startup valued at US$3.1 billion, as well as Eon, a data-backup firm, and Kela, a defense-tech company.
Maguire said Sequoia has completed three new investments in Israel, including two cybersecurity deals this year.
He noted that reduced foreign VC activity in the country has created more opportunities for active investors.
